Victorian Town House Hotel, incorporating the South Restaurant & Bar, 3 conference rooms, with Wedding Licenced premises.The South Lodge Hotel is an attractive Victorian town house located within a ten minute walk from Chelmsford Town Centre and the County Cricket ground. Only a short distance from the A12 and 14 miles from the M25, the hotel is ideal for business and the leisure travellers alike.For private dining or business meetings we have a number of private rooms, again all extensively furbished to offer the perfect venue for either a celebration meal or that all important board meeting.
